ZIP 79518 and ZIP 79521 are ZIP Code areas in Texas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 79521 has the higher population (3,470 vs 115 in ZIP 79518). ZIP 79521 has the higher median household income ($61,609 vs $34,063 in ZIP 79518). ZIP 79521 has the higher median home value ($108,900 vs $67,500 in ZIP 79518).
